    Windows 7: LogonUI.exe - No Disk

    Well I have recently purchased a new laptop on which I have installed Windows 7 on it. I have transferred the old profile to the new system from the old computer. I am having F: as the primary hard drive rather than C: Whenever I try to logoff from the system I am getting following error message which states that LogonUI.exe - No Disk. There is no disk in the drive. Please insert a disk into the drive \Device\Harddisk2\DR2. It prompts three options which are Cancel, Try again, Continue. However none of works to solve the matter.     Re: Windows 7: LogonUI.exe - No Disk

    Well I am having a solution in this particular situation to solve the matter.
    1. You have to login on your computer as Administrator.
    2. You have to insert disk on removable disk. Now right click on the My Computer and select Manage
    3. Now choose Disk Management. Now you have to choose desire drive and click on Change Drive Letter and Paths.
    4. Now you have to click on removable drive and simply click on change and choose the desired drive from the list and click Ok to apply.

    Re: Windows 7: LogonUI.exe - No Disk

    I have successfully solved the issue in this particular situation. Well I let you know why it was happening. I was using G drive to install Operating system on the old computer of mine. However in the new computer of mine G drive was allotted as SD card or for removable disk. I had simply modified the disk name with the next available letter and I have solved the issue. From where I am not having any issue.
